Jogging around Zettachwald offers a diverse natural environment characterized by expansive woodlands and open meadows. The region features well-maintained paths suitable for various fitness levels, providing both shaded forest sections and sunlit areas. The Körsch stream flows through the area, adding a tranquil element to many routes. This protected nature reserve near Stuttgart provides an accessible setting for active recreation.

On February 17, 1922, the carter Gottlob Ruckaberle died near Möhringen. He was attacked, robbed, and beaten to death with a stone. A memorial stone commemorates the carter, who had brought stones from the Schönbuch to Stuttgart for the construction of the main train station. The murder was never solved.

There are over 1,200 running routes around Zettachwald, catering to various fitness levels. You'll find a wide selection, from easy, flat paths to more challenging trails with moderate elevation changes.
Zettachwald offers a diverse natural environment with expansive woodlands and open meadows, providing both shaded forest paths and sunlit areas. The tranquil Körsch stream flows through the area, adding a peaceful backdrop to many routes. The network of well-maintained paths is suitable for various fitness levels, making it an ideal spot for active recreation.

Many of the running routes in Zettachwald are designed as loops, allowing you to start and finish at the same point. For example, the Weidach and Zettachwald Path – View of the Swabian Jura loop from Salzäcker is a moderate 6.2 km circular trail that offers scenic views.
While jogging in Zettachwald, you can enjoy diverse forest and meadow ecosystems. A significant natural feature is the tranquil Körsch River in Weidach and Zettach Forest, which accompanies many routes. You might also encounter the impressive Giant Sequoia in Körschtal or the Path Through the Körschtal Valley.
Yes, several routes offer scenic views. For instance, the View of the Swabian Jura loop from Schelmenwasen provides glimpses towards the Swabian Jura. The region's varied landscape often opens up to pleasant vistas, especially in areas where woodlands meet open meadows.

Zettachwald is beautiful year-round. In spring, the forest floor transforms into a vibrant carpet of two-leafed bluebells, offering a particularly picturesque experience. Summer provides shaded forest paths, while autumn brings colorful foliage. Even in winter, the well-covered paths can be suitable for running, though conditions may vary.
While Zettachwald is primarily a natural reserve, its proximity to Stuttgart means there are cafes and restaurants in nearby communities. You might find options in areas like Fasanenhof or Plieningen, which are often starting points or accessible from some of the running routes.
The terrain in Zettachwald is characterized by a mix of forest paths and open meadow trails, generally well-maintained. Elevation changes are typically moderate, making most routes accessible. For example, the Southern Dürrlwangäcker – Pathway Along the Schwarzbach loop from Europaplatz has an elevation gain of about 32 meters over 7.6 km, offering a relatively flat experience.
